Hernia Repair Surgery in South Dakota: What to Know
South Dakota offers robust options for hernia repair. High-volume facilities like Sanford USD Medical Center and Avera McKennan Hospital in Sioux Falls perform hundreds of cases annually. Robotic-assisted surgery, providing smaller incisions and faster recovery, is available at locations like Brookings Health System and The Surgical Institute of South Dakota. Minimally invasive techniques are also utilized at Prairie Lakes General Surgery Clinic in Watertown to expedite recovery.
For potentially lower costs, consider outpatient hernia repair at Ambulatory Surgical Centers (ASCs), such as the Yankton Medical Clinic ASC, which serves patients from multiple states. These centers typically offer more affordable options compared to outpatient hospitals. Verify current pricing directly with providers.

Facility Costs in South Dakota
Here are the highest-volume hernia repair surgery providers in South Dakota. All rates come from CMS Medicare claims data — actual payments, not list prices.
| Facility | City | Negotiated Rate | Medicare | Volume |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sanford Usd Medical Center | Sioux Falls | $5,129 | $4,087 | 219 |
| Sanford Usd Medical Center | Sioux Falls | $8,915 | $7,317 | 198 |
| Avera Mckennan Hospital & University Health Center | Sioux Falls | $5,129 | $4,088 | 193 |
| Avera Mckennan Hospital & University Health Center | Sioux Falls | $8,898 | $7,298 | 186 |
| Monument Health Rapid City Hospital | Rapid City | $5,466 | $4,349 | 161 |
| Monument Health Rapid City Hospital | Rapid City | $9,570 | $7,969 | 118 |
| Monument Health Spearfish Hospital | Spearfish | $5,426 | $4,309 | 65 |
| Avera St Lukes | Aberdeen | $5,129 | $4,086 | 64 |
| Dunes Surgical Hospital | Dakota Dunes | $4,970 | $3,920 | 47 |
| Monument Health Spearfish Hospital | Spearfish | $9,570 | $7,970 | 38 |

How we calculate hernia repair surgery costs in South Dakota
Cost estimates combine procedure-specific pricing data with regional cost-of-living and provider-supply adjustments. Primary sources:
-
•
Hospital pricing transparency files — CMS-required machine-readable data published by hospitals under the CMS Hospital Price Transparency rule (effective January 2021). Provides actual negotiated rates between hospitals and insurers.
-
•
HCUP (Healthcare Cost & Utilization Project) — AHRQ's HCUP databases provide nationally-representative procedure cost data by state, payer, and patient demographics.
-
•
Bureau of Labor Statistics — Healthcare Practitioner Occupational Wages — BLS OEWS data on surgeon, anesthesiologist, and surgical staff wages by state, used to model regional labor-cost differences in procedure pricing.
-
•
BEA Regional Price Parities (RPP) — U.S. Bureau of Economic Analysis state-level price-level indices, used to adjust national procedure averages for South Dakota's cost-of-living relative to the national mean.
-
•
FAIR Health Consumer Cost Lookup — the FAIR Health database aggregates billed and allowed amounts from over 36 billion claim records, providing a check on procedure-cost ranges by ZIP code.
-
•
Medicare Provider Utilization & Payment Data — CMS public-use files on Medicare-allowed amounts and submitted charges by HCPCS/CPT code and state, used as a baseline for procedure-cost ranges.
Estimates are illustrative and reflect typical pricing ranges; actual costs depend on insurance coverage, surgical complexity, anesthesia type, hospital vs. ambulatory setting, and individual patient factors.
